Output d656cf2e0512fc170cb3fd3cbcd833ef14ed9e53ac75b2e60361c186ac0371fe:0

value
16352315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38af21f1c8e8c2638c60020413aaaf44c97ea0de OP_EQUAL
address
36rjZiGX15WJZXZjWcaHbybRuhzKW6aNud
transaction
d656cf2e0512fc170cb3fd3cbcd833ef14ed9e53ac75b2e60361c186ac0371fe